/*!
* \page Changes Differences to Log4j
*
* The following fundamental differences exist between %Log4Qt and Log4j:
*
* - As a JAVA package Log4j does not have to manage object ownership and
* lifetime in the same way then it is required in C++. For details on
* how object ownership is handled see \ref Ownership "Object ownership".
* - The package uses itself for its internal logging similar to Log4j 1.3.
* For details see \ref LogLog "Logging within the package".
* - The configuration using system properties was replaced with a combination
* of environment variables and application settings. For details see
* \ref Env "Environment Variables".
* - Custom levels are not supported.
* - Multiple Logger Repositories are not supported
*
* The following classes have been changed:
*
* - \ref Log4Qt::AppenderSkeleton "AppenderSkeleton"
* - The procedure of checking, if logging is possible, originally used by
* \ref Log4Qt::WriterAppender "WriterAppender" was generalised and is used
* in \ref Log4Qt::AppenderSkeleton "AppenderSkeleton" and derived classes
* (\ref Log4Qt::AppenderSkeleton::checkEntryConditions() "checkEntryConditions()").
* - The \ref Log4Qt::AppenderSkeleton::doAppend() "doAppend()" member function will
* check the entry conditions by calling the sub-class specific
* \ref Log4Qt::AppenderSkeleton::checkEntryConditions() "checkEntryConditions()".
* If successful the sub-class specific
* \ref Log4Qt::AppenderSkeleton::append() "append()" function is called.
*
* - Configurator
* - Configure functions return a boolean indicating, if the configuration
* was successful.
* - Configure errors are accessible over
* \ref Log4Qt::ConfiguratorHelper::configureError()
* "ConfiguratorHelper::configureError()".
* - Watching for configuration file changes is a function performed
* centrally by the \ref Log4Qt::ConfiguratorHelper "ConfiguratorHelper".
* The class provides signals to notify on configuration change and errors.
* - The class \ref Log4Qt::PropertyConfigurator "PropertyConfigurator" was
* extended to be able to read configuration data from a QSettings object.
*
* - \ref Log4Qt::Level "Level"
* - A new value \ref Log4Qt::Level::NULL_INT "Level::NULL_INT" was
* introduced to indicate there is no level set.
*
* - \ref Log4Qt::Logger "Logger"
* - The method \ref Log4Qt::Logger::isEnabledFor() "isEnabledFor()"
* does also take the repository threshold into account.
* - Several overloaded convenience member function are available to log
* messages with arguments of different types.
* - Two macros, \ref Log4Qt::LOG4QT_DECLARE_STATIC_LOGGER "LOG4QT_DECLARE_STATIC_LOGGER"
* and \ref Log4Qt::LOG4QT_DECLARE_QCLASS_LOGGER "LOG4QT_DECLARE_QCLASS_LOGGER",
* allows retrieving and caching of a pointer to a logger object.
*
* - \ref Log4Qt::LogManager "LogManager"
* - A QtMessage handler can be installed via
* \ref Log4Qt::LogManager::setHandleQtMessages() "setHandleQtMessages()",
* to redirect all messages created by calls to qDebug(), qWarning(),
* qCritical() and qFatal() to a logger. The logger is named Qt and can be
* accessed using \ref Log4Qt::LogManager::qtLogger() "qtLogger()".
* - The initialisation procedure is available over a public method
* (\ref Log4Qt::LogManager::startup() "startup()").
* - The LogManager provides access to the logger used internally by the
* package (\ref Log4Qt::LogManager::logLogger() "logLogger()") and to
* its default initialisation procedure
* (\ref Log4Qt::LogManager::configureLogLogger() "configureLogLogger()").
*
* - \ref Log4Qt::WriterAppender "WriterAppender"
* - The class will call \ref Log4Qt::WriterAppender::handleIoErrors()
* "handleIoErrors()" after all I/O operations. Sub-classes should
* re-implement the function to handle errors.
*
* The following classes have been added:
*
* - An additional appender class, \ref Log4Qt::DebugAppender "DebugAppender",
* was added. The class appends logging events to the platform specific debug
* output.
* - Various helper class have been introduced:
* - \ref Log4Qt::ClassLogger "ClassLogger": The class ClassLogger provides
* logging for a QObject derived class.
* - \ref Log4Qt::ConfiguratorHelper "ConfiguratorHelper": The class
* ConfiguratorHelper provides a configuration file watch and last error
* for configurator classes.
* - \ref Log4Qt::DateTime "DateTime": The class DateTime provides extended
* functionality for QDateTime.
* - \ref Log4Qt::LogError "LogError": The class LogError represents an error.
* - \ref Log4Qt::Factory "Factory": The class Factory provides factories
* for Appender, Filter and Layout objects.
* - \ref Log4Qt::InitialisationHelper "InitialisationHelper": The class
* InitialisationHelper performs static initialisation tasks.
* - \ref Log4Qt::LogObject "LogObject": The class LogObject is the common
* base class for many classes in the package.
* - \ref Log4Qt::LogObjectPtr "LogObjectPtr": The class LogObjectPtr
* implements automatic reference counting for LogObject objects.
* - \ref Log4Qt::PatternFormatter "PatternFormatter": The class
* PatternFormatter formats a logging event based on a pattern string.
* - \ref Log4Qt::Properties "Properties": The class Properties implements a
* JAVA property hash.
*/
/*!
* \page Ownership Object ownership
*
* In difference to the JAVA Log4j package %Log4Qt must manage ownership and
* lifetime of the objects used. This is non trivial as objects are created
* and used in different ways.
*
* In general an object can be created explicitly for example an application
* may create Loggers, Appenders and Layouts during creation of a QApplication
* object. But they can also be automatically created by the package on
* startup using a \ref Log4Qt::PropertyConfigurator "PropertyConfigurator"
* configuration file. Objects may also be created the one way and then used
* the other. Object may be used by multiple other objects. A Layout for example
* may be used by multiple Appenders. Objects are also created from multiple
* threads. The creation may happen during static initialisation and the
* deletion during static de-initialization.
*
* The parent child model used by QObject cannot be used to handle this. It
* cannot automatically delete an object that is used by multiple others as
* for example an Appender used by multiple Loggers. In addition to this
* QObjects and their children must reside in the same thread. This would
* either mean to impose restriction on how objects can be created or to move
* objects to a specific thread.
*
* To allow an automatic deletion of not required objects the package
* implements reference counting for Appenders, Layouts and Filters. The
* reference counting is implemented in \ref Log4Qt::LogObject "LogObject",
* which is used as a common base class. The reference count can be explicitly
* changed using the methods \ref Log4Qt::LogObject::retain() "retain()" and
* \ref Log4Qt::LogObject::release() "release()". Alternatively an auto pointer
* is available \ref Log4Qt::LogObjectPtr "LogObjectPtr", which is used
* throughout the package.
*
* The reference counting mechanism will test, if an object has a QObject
* parent object set. If a parent is set, the object will not be deleted, if
* the reference count reaches 0. This allows to mix the reference counted
* paradigm with the QObject parent child one.
*
* The following example configures a logger and uses reference counting to
* manage the ownership of objects.
*
* \code
* // Create layout
* TTCCLayout *p_layout = new TTCCLayout();
*
* // Create appender
* ConsoleAppender *p_appender = new ConsoleAppender(p_layout, ConsoleAppender::STDOUT_TARGET);
* p_appender->activateOptions();
*
* // Get logger
* Logger *p_logger = Logger::logger("MyClass");
* p_logger->addAppender(p_appender);
*
* // ...
*
* // Remove appender from Logger
* p_logger->removeAllAppenders(); // p_appender and p_layout are deleted here
* \endcode
*
* The following example configures a logger and uses QObject ownership of
* objects.
*
* \code
* QObject *p_parent = new MyObject;
*
* // Create objects
* ConsoleAppender *p_appender = new ConsoleAppender(p_parent);
* TTCCLayout *p_layout = new TTCCLayout(p_appender);
*
* // Configure appender
* p_appender->setTarget(ConsoleAppender::STDOUT_TARGET);
* p_appender->setLayout(p_layout);
* p_appender->activateOptions();
*
* // Get logger
* Logger *p_logger = Logger::logger("MyClass");
* p_logger->addAppender(p_appender);
*
* // ...
*
* // Remove appender from Logger
* p_logger->removeAllAppenders();
*
* delete p_parent; // p_appender and p_layout are deleted here
* \endcode
*
* The following example shows how to use objects created on the stack.
*
* \code
* {
* // Create layout
* TTCCLayout layout;
* layout.retain();
*
* // Create appender
* ConsoleAppender appender(&layout, ConsoleAppender::STDOUT_TARGET);
* appender.retain();
* appender.activateOptions();
*
* // Get logger
* Logger *p_logger = Logger::logger("MyClass");
* p_logger->addAppender(&appender);
*
* // ...
*
* // Remove appender from Logger
* p_logger->removeAllAppenders(); // Without retain() program crashes here
*
* } // p_appender and p_layout are deleted here
* \endcode
*/
/*!
* \page LogLog Logging within the package
*
* The package uses itself for logging similar to Log4j 1.3. This brings much
* more flexibility over logging to stdout, stderr like in Log4j 1.2 using
* logLog. It also enables the program to capture and handle errors raised by
* the package.
*
* Using this approach introduces the issue of recursion. The following example
* explains a situation where this happens. Let's say all logger are configured
* to be additive and only the root logger has an appender set. The appender
* is a \ref Log4Qt::FileAppender "FileAppender". During the logging of an
* event an I/O error occurs. The \ref Log4Qt::FileAppender "FileAppender" logs
* an event by itself using the logger %Log4Qt::FileAppender. The event is
* passed to the root logger, which calls then the \ref Log4Qt::FileAppender
* "FileAppender". This causes another I/O error, which is logged by
* the \ref Log4Qt::FileAppender "FileAppender".
*
* To avoid an endless loop the appender will drop the event on a recursive
* invocation. This check is done by \ref Log4Qt::AppenderSkeleton
* "AppenderSkeleton" in \ref Log4Qt::AppenderSkeleton::doAppend()
* "doAppend()".
*
* The problem only occurs, if a logger, appender, layout or filter log an
* event while an event is appended. Neither the logger class nor any of the
* layout or filter classes log events during appending of an event. Most of
* the appender classes may log errors during appending. Only the
* \ref Log4Qt::ListAppender "ListAppender" and
* \ref Log4Qt::ListAppender "ConsoleAppender" are not logging events.
*
* The default configuration uses two \ref Log4Qt::ListAppender
* "ConsoleAppender", one for stderr and one for stdout. No event will be
* dropped, because no recursive invocations can occur.
*/
/*!
* \page Init Initialization procedure
*
* The package is initialised in two stages. The first stage takes place during
* static initialization. The second stage takes place when the
* \ref Log4Qt::LogManager "LogManager" singleton is created.
*
* During static initialisation the \ref Log4Qt::InitialisationHelper
* "InitialisationHelper" singleton is created . On construction it captures
* the program startup time, reads the required values from the system
* environment and registers the package types with the Qt type system.
*
* The \ref Log4Qt::LogManager "LogManager" singleton is created on first use.
* The creation is usually triggered by the request for a \ref Log4Qt::Logger
* "Logger" object. The call to \ref Log4Qt::Logger::logger()
* "Logger::logger()" is passed through to \ref Log4Qt::LogManager::logger()
* "LogManager::logger()". On creation the \ref Log4Qt::LogManager "LogManager"
* creates a \ref Log4Qt::Hierarchy "Hierarchy" object as logger repository.
*
* After the singleton is created the logging of the package is configured to
* its default by a call to \ref Log4Qt::LogManager::configureLogLogger()
* "LogManager::configureLogLogger()". The logger
* \ref Log4Qt::LogManager::logLogger() "logLogger()" is configured to be not
* additive. Messages with the level \ref Log4Qt::Level::ERROR_INT
* "Level::ERROR_INT" and \ref Log4Qt::Level::FATAL_INT "Level::FATAL_INT" are
* written to \c stderr using a ConsoleAppender. The remaining messages are
* written to \c stdout using a second ConsoleAppender. The level is read from
* the system environment or application settings using
* \ref Log4Qt::InitialisationHelper::setting()
* "InitialisationHelper::setting()" with the key \c Debug. If a level value
* is found, but it is not a valid Level string,
* \ref Log4Qt::Level::DEBUG_INT "Level::DEBUG_INT" is used. If no level string
* is found \ref Log4Qt::Level::ERROR_INT "Level::ERROR_INT" is used.
*
* Once the logging is configured the package is initialised by a call to
* \ref Log4Qt::LogManager::startup() "LogManager::startup()". The function
* will test for the setting \c DefaultInitOverride in the system environment
* and application settings using \ref Log4Qt::InitialisationHelper::setting()
* "InitialisationHelper::setting()". If the value is present and set to
* anything else then \c false, the initialisation is aborted.<br>
* The system environment and application settings are tested for the setting
* \c Configuration. If it is found and it is a valid path to a file, the
* package is configured with the file using
* \ref Log4Qt::PropertyConfigurator::doConfigure(const QString &, LoggerRepository *)
* "PropertyConfigurator::doConfigure()". If the setting \c Configuration is
* not available and a QCoreApplication object is present, the application
* settings are tested for a group \c Properties. If the group exists,
* the package is configured with the setting using the
* \ref Log4Qt::PropertyConfigurator::doConfigure(const QSettings &r, LoggerRepository *)
* "PropertyConfiguratordoConfigure()". If neither a configuration file nor
* configuration settings could be found, the current working directory is
* searched for the file \c "log4qt.properties". If it is found, the package
* is configured with the file using
* \ref Log4Qt::PropertyConfigurator::doConfigure(const QString &, LoggerRepository *)
* "PropertyConfigurator::doConfigure()".
*
* The following example shows how to use application settings to initialise the
* package.
*
* \code
* # file: myapplication.h
*
* #include qapplication.h
*
* class MyApplication : public QApplication
* {
* Q_OBJECT
*
* public:
* MyApplication();
* ~MyApplication();
* void setupLog4Qt();
* }
* \endcode
* \code
* # file: myapplication.cpp
*
* #include myapplication.h
*
* MyApplication::MyApplication(
* {
* // Set Application data to allow Log4Qt initialisation to read the
* // correct values
* setApplicationName("MyApplication");
* setOrganisationName("MyOrganisation");
* setOrganizationDomain("www.myorganisation.com");
*
* // Log first message, which initialises Log4Qt
* Log4Qt::Logger::logger("MyApplication")->info("Hello World");
* }
*
* MyApplication::~MyApplication()
* {
* }
*
* void MyApplication::setupLog4Qt()
* {
* QSettings s;
*
* // Set logging level for Log4Qt to TRACE
* s.beginGroup("Log4Qt");
* s.setValue("Debug", "TRACE");
*
* // Configure logging to log to the file C:/myapp.log using the level TRACE
* s.beginGroup("Properties");
* s.setValue("log4j.appender.A1", "org.apache.log4j.FileAppender");
* s.setValue("log4j.appender.A1.file", "C:/myapp.log");
* s.setValue("log4j.appender.A1.layout", "org.apache.log4j.TTCCLayout");
* s.setValue("log4j.appender.A1.layout.DateFormat", "ISO8601");
* s.setValue("log4j.rootLogger", "TRACE, A1");
*
* // Settings will become active on next application startup
* }
* \endcode
*/
/*!
* \page Env Environment Variables
*
* The package uses environment variables to control the initialization
* procedure. The environment variables replace the system property entries
* used by Log4j.
*
* For compability reasons the Log4j entry is recognised. Alternatively a
* environment variable style Log4Qt form can be used. The following entries
* are used:
*
* - LOG4QT_DEBUG<br>
* The variable controls the \ref Log4Qt::Level "Level" value for the
* logger \ref Log4Qt::LogManager::logLogger() "LogManager::logLogger()".
* If the value is a valid \ref Log4Qt::Level "Level" string, the level for
* the is set to the level. If the value is not a valid
* \ref Log4Qt::Level "Level" string, \ref Log4Qt::Level::DEBUG_INT
* "DEBUG_INT" is used. Otherwise \ref Log4Qt::Level::ERROR_INT "ERROR_INT"
* is used.
* - \ref Log4Qt::LogManager::configureLogLogger()
* "LogManager::configureLogLogger()"
*
* - LOG4QT_DEFAULTINITOVERRIDE<br>
* The variable controls the \ref Init "initialization procedure" performed
* by the \ref Log4Qt::LogManager "LogManager" on startup. If it is set to
* any other value then \c false the \ref Init "initialization procedure"
* is skipped.
* - \ref Log4Qt::LogManager::startup() "LogManager::startup()"
*
* - LOG4QT_CONFIGURATION<br>
* The variable specifies the configuration file used for initialising the
* package.
* - \ref Log4Qt::LogManager::startup() "LogManager::startup()"
*
* - LOG4QT_CONFIGURATORCLASS<br>
* The variable specifies the configurator class used for initialising the
* package.
*
* Environment variables are read during static initialisation on creation of
* the \ref Log4Qt::InitialisationHelper "InitialisationHelper". They can be
* accessed by calling \ref Log4Qt::InitialisationHelper::environmentSettings()
* "InitialisationHelper::environmentSettings()".
*
* All settings can also be made in the application settings under the group
* \c %Log4Qt. For example the environment variable \c LOG4QT_DEBUG is
* equivalent to the setting \c Debug. If an environment variable is
* set it takes precedence over the application setting. Settings are only
* used, if an QApplication object is available, when the
* \ref Log4Qt::LogManager "LogManager" is
* initialised (see \ref Log4Qt::InitialisationHelper::setting()
* "InitialisationHelper::setting()" for details).
*/
/*!
* \page Undocumented Undocumented functions
*
* In general it was tried to avoid the usage of undocumented features of Qt.
* Nice to have features like for example Q_DECLARE_PRIVATE are not used. Only
* features that would have been resulted in re-coding the same functionality
* are used.
*
* - QT_WA: The macro is used to call Windows A/W functions
* - \ref Log4Qt::DebugAppender "DebugAppender"
* - QBasicAtomicPointer: The class is used instead of QAtomicPointer, because
* it allows the initialisation as plain old data type.
* - \ref Log4Qt::LOG4QT_GLOBAL_STATIC "LOG4QT_GLOBAL_STATIC"
* - \ref Log4Qt::LOG4QT_IMPLEMENT_INSTANCE "LOG4QT_IMPLEMENT_INSTANCE"
* - \ref Log4Qt::LOG4QT_DECLARE_STATIC_LOGGER "LOG4QT_DECLARE_STATIC_LOGGER"
* - Q_BASIC_ATOMIC_INITIALIZER: The macro is used to initialise QAtomicPointer
* objects as plain old data type.
* - \ref Log4Qt::LOG4QT_GLOBAL_STATIC "LOG4QT_GLOBAL_STATIC"
* - \ref Log4Qt::LOG4QT_IMPLEMENT_INSTANCE "LOG4QT_IMPLEMENT_INSTANCE"
* - \ref Log4Qt::LOG4QT_DECLARE_STATIC_LOGGER "LOG4QT_DECLARE_STATIC_LOGGER"
*/
